rtl design meaning

# **|Reveal the Hidden Power of RTL Design: A Game-Changer in Web Development!|** In the vast world of web design, one term often flies under the radar but holds immense potential: RTL (Right-to-Left) design. If you’re not familiar with it, you’re in for a treat! This article will dive deep into the meaning of RTL design, its impact on web development, and why it’s becoming a crucial skill for modern designers. Get ready to unlock the secrets behind this groundbreaking technique! ## Introduction to RTL Design ### What is RTL Design? RTL design, as the name suggests, is a design approach that supports the writing and reading of text from right to left. Unlike the standard Left-to-Right (LTR) layout that we are all accustomed to, RTL design is used primarily for languages like Arabic, Hebrew, Persian, and Urdu. It’s a significant aspect of web accessibility and ensures that all users, regardless of their linguistic background, can access and interact with websites seamlessly. ### The Evolution of Web Design Web design has come a long way since the early days of the internet. As the world becomes more diverse, the need for inclusive design has become increasingly important. RTL design is a testament to the industry’s commitment to catering to a global audience. It’s no longer just about making websites visually appealing; it’s about making them functional and accessible for everyone. ## The Impact of RTL Design on Web Development ### Enhanced User Experience One of the primary goals of web development is to provide a seamless user experience. RTL design plays a crucial role in achieving this by catering to users who prefer right-to-left languages. By implementing RTL design, developers can ensure that the content is displayed correctly, and users can navigate the website without any confusion. ### Accessibility for Diverse Languages With the rise of globalization, the internet has become a melting pot of different cultures and languages. RTL design allows websites to support a wider range of languages, making them more inclusive and accessible. This, in turn, helps businesses and organizations reach a broader audience and tap into new markets. ### SEO and Search Engine Rankings Implementing RTL design can also have a positive impact on search engine optimization (SEO). By supporting multiple languages, websites can rank higher in search engine results for users who prefer right-to-left languages. This can lead to increased organic traffic and improved visibility. ## The Challenges of RTL Design ### Design Overhaul Adapting a website to RTL design requires a significant overhaul of its layout. Developers need to ensure that the content, images, and other elements are displayed correctly in both LTR and RTL modes. This can be a complex and time-consuming process, especially for websites with intricate designs. ### Testing and Quality Assurance Thorough testing is essential when implementing RTL design. Developers need to ensure that the website functions correctly in both layouts and that there are no bugs or errors. This can be challenging, as it requires testing on multiple devices and browsers. ### Cross-Cultural Considerations When designing for RTL languages, it’s important to consider cultural nuances and preferences. This includes using appropriate images, icons, and fonts that resonate with the target audience. ## Implementing RTL Design in HTML ### Step-by-Step Guide 1. **Add the `dir` attribute**: To specify the text direction for an HTML element, add the `dir` attribute with the value `rtl` to the `` tag. For example: ``. 2. **Use CSS for styling**: Apply CSS styles to your elements to ensure they are displayed correctly in RTL mode. Pay attention to the alignment, padding, and margin properties. 3. **Adjust images and media**: Ensure that images and other media elements are displayed correctly in RTL mode. You may need to flip or rotate some elements to maintain their visual appeal. 4. **Test thoroughly**: Test your website in both LTR and RTL modes to ensure that everything functions correctly. ### Best Practices – **Use responsive design**: Ensure that your website is responsive and adapts to different screen sizes and orientations. – **Optimize for performance**: Minimize the use of heavy CSS and JavaScript to ensure that your website loads quickly in both LTR and RTL modes. – **Stay updated**: Keep yourself informed about the latest trends and best practices in web design and development. ## Conclusion RTL design is a powerful and essential tool for web developers and designers who want to create inclusive and accessible websites. By understanding the meaning and impact of RTL design, you can unlock the full potential of your web development skills and cater to a global audience. So, don’t miss out on this game-changing technique and start implementing RTL design in your projects today! By following the guidelines and best practices outlined in this article, you’ll be well on your way to creating websites that are not only visually appealing but also functional and accessible for users who prefer right-to-left languages. Remember, the future of web design is inclusive, and RTL design is a key component of that future.

Leave a Comment